From Barranquilla to Breakthrough: Early Life and Career Foundations

Born in Barranquilla, Colombia, Sofia Vergara’s story began far from the glittering lights of Hollywood. Her striking beauty and vibrant personality caught the attention of a scout while she was walking on a beach, leading to her first opportunities in modeling and television. In the early 1990s, she quickly became a recognized face in Latin American entertainment, notably co-hosting the popular travel show ‘Fuera de Serie’ on Univision. This role saw her traveling the world, honing her on-screen presence, and developing the comedic timing that would later define her career.

Her ambitions soon led her to the United States, where she began to explore opportunities in the American film and television industry. Between 1995 and 2008, Sofia took on a variety of smaller roles, gradually building her resume and gaining valuable experience. These early projects included appearances in films such as ‘Chasing Papi’ (2003), where she showcased her burgeoning comedic chops, ‘Four Brothers’ (2005), where she demonstrated a more dramatic range, and television series like ‘Dirty Sexy Money.’ During this period, Sofia meticulously worked to refine her craft, adapt to a new cultural landscape, and overcome the challenges of breaking into a highly competitive industry. Her persistent efforts during these foundational years laid the groundwork for the extraordinary success that was just around the corner, proving that her unique blend of humor, beauty, and resilience was a force to be reckoned with.

The ‘Modern Family’ Phenomenon: Crafting an Icon with Gloria Delgado-Pritchett

The year 2009 marked a pivotal turning point in Sofia Vergara’s career when she landed the role of Gloria Delgado-Pritchett in Christopher Lloyd and Steven Levitan’s groundbreaking comedy series, ‘Modern Family.’ For an incredible 11 seasons and over 250 episodes, Sofia embodied Gloria with an unforgettable blend of fiery passion, unwavering maternal instinct, and uproarious comedic flair. As the vivacious Colombian wife of Jay Pritchett (played by the legendary Ed O’Neill) and devoted mother to Manny (Rico Rodriguez) and later Joe, Gloria quickly became a fan favorite, captivating audiences worldwide with her distinctive accent, expressive personality, and heart of gold.

Sofia’s portrayal of Gloria was revolutionary, challenging stereotypes while celebrating her character’s cultural identity. She brought an authenticity and depth to Gloria that resonated deeply with viewers, making her a beloved figure in the landscape of television sitcoms. Her comedic chemistry with the entire cast, especially Ed O’Neill, was a cornerstone of the show’s success, contributing to countless memorable moments and hilarious family dynamics. The role not only showcased Sofia’s exceptional talent but also cemented her status as a global superstar. Her performance garnered immense critical acclaim, earning her four Emmy nominations for Outstanding Supporting Actress in a Comedy Series and four Golden Globe nominations for Best Performance by an Actress in a Supporting Role in a Series, Miniseries or Motion Picture Made for Television between 2010 and 2014. These consistent accolades underscored her powerful impact on the show and her significant contribution to its widespread popularity, transforming her into one of the highest-paid and most recognized actresses in the industry.

Beyond Primetime: Expanding Her Reach in Film and Business

The immense success and visibility Sofia Vergara gained from ‘Modern Family’ opened numerous doors, allowing her to expand her presence across various entertainment and business ventures. Her rising popularity translated into a slew of major film roles, where she continued to showcase her versatility and comedic prowess. She appeared in ensemble comedies like ‘New Year’s Eve’ (2011), demonstrating her ability to shine among a star-studded cast. Her turn in the feel-good film ‘Chef’ (2014) alongside Jon Favreau was well-received, further proving her range beyond just one character.

One of her most notable post-‘Modern Family’ film projects was ‘Hot Pursuit’ (2015), where she starred opposite Academy Award winner Reese Witherspoon. This buddy-comedy allowed Sofia to flex her comedic muscles in a leading role, creating a memorable on-screen dynamic with Witherspoon that delighted audiences. She also lent her voice to animated features like ‘The Emoji Movie’ (2017), showcasing her appeal across different entertainment formats and to a younger demographic. Beyond acting, Sofia has proven to be an astute businesswoman. She leveraged her global appeal into numerous lucrative endorsements and successful entrepreneurial ventures. This includes launching her own clothing line, ‘Sofia by Sofia Vergara,’ at Kmart, which offered accessible fashion to her vast fanbase. She also ventured into fragrances, producing a popular line of perfumes, and even furniture with ‘Sofia Home by Rooms To Go.’ These endeavors highlight her keen business acumen and her ability to build a formidable brand extending far beyond her acting career, making her a powerful figure in both Hollywood and the business world.

Love, Family, and Resilience: A Glimpse into Sofia’s Personal Life

While her professional life soared, Sofia Vergara’s personal journey has been equally rich and impactful. She became a mother at a young age, welcoming her son, Manolo Gonzalez Vergara, in September 1992, during her first marriage to her high school sweetheart, Joe Gonzalez (1991-1993). Raising her son as a single mother while simultaneously building her career in a new country speaks volumes about her strength and determination. Her deep bond with Manolo is often highlighted in interviews and on social media, showcasing a loving and supportive family unit.

In more recent years, Sofia found love again, entering a high-profile relationship with ‘True Blood’ and ‘Magic Mike’ star, Joe Manganiello. The couple began dating in 2014, and after a whirlwind six-month romance, they became engaged on Christmas Day of that same year. Their fairytale wedding in November 2015, held in Palm Beach, Florida, was a celebrated event, reflecting their vibrant personalities and deep affection for each other. Their relationship quickly became a fan favorite, known for their playful banter, mutual support, and stunning public appearances. Beyond the glitz and glamour, Sofia has also openly shared her personal battle with thyroid cancer, which she successfully overcame in the early 2000s. Her candor about this health challenge serves as an inspiration, demonstrating her resilience and courage in the face of adversity, adding another layer to her compelling life story.

A New Chapter: Judging ‘America’s Got Talent’ and Future Endeavors

Always one to embrace new challenges and expand her professional horizons, Sofia Vergara embarked on an exciting new chapter in her career by joining the judging panel of NBC’s hit reality competition series, ‘America’s Got Talent.’ Stepping into this role for the show’s 15th season, Sofia brought her signature humor, empathetic nature, and discerning eye to the talent search. Her presence on the panel alongside long-standing judges Simon Cowell, Howie Mandel, and fellow ‘Modern Family’ alum Heidi Klum, injected fresh energy and a unique perspective into the beloved competition.

As a judge, Sofia connected with contestants and audiences alike through her genuine reactions, heartfelt encouragement, and often hilarious commentary. Her ability to balance constructive criticism with an infectious warmth has made her a beloved figure on the show. This transition showcased her adaptability and willingness to venture into new formats, proving that her appeal transcends scripted comedy.
